A China-linked APT group called UAT-9244 has been targeting telecommunications providers in South America since 2024, deploying three new malware tools to gain deep access into critical network infrastructure. This campaign highlights the value of telecom networks for state-sponsored intelligence collection and underscores the need for enhanced security measures among content creators and telecommunication companies.
